School Bus Crash in Caledon Shuts Down Major Road, Police Say
School Bus Crash Shuts Down Caledon Road

A school bus crash in Caledon has forced the closure of a major road, according to police. The incident occurred on the morning of April 24, 2026, and authorities are currently on the scene investigating.

Emergency services responded to the crash, which involved a yellow school bus. Fortunately, no serious injuries have been reported. The cause of the crash is under investigation, and police have not yet released details about the driver or any passengers.

Road Closure and Traffic Impact

The affected road remains closed in both directions, causing significant traffic disruptions in the area. Motorists are advised to avoid the vicinity and seek alternative routes. Local authorities are working to clear the scene and restore normal traffic flow as soon as possible.

Community Response

Local officials have expressed concern over the safety of school transportation. The school board is cooperating with police to ensure all students and staff are accounted for. Parents are being notified through official channels.

Further updates will be provided as more information becomes available.
